Champions League 2025-2026: Marseille-Newcastle, the likely lineups

Marseille hosts Newcastle on the fifth day of the Champions League single group stage. Kickoff at 9 p.m. at the Velodrome. L’OM comes from a bitter third loss in Europe against Atalanta, a result that leaves it stuck on three points. The Magpies, on the other hand, are experiencing an extraordinary moment of form: after overcoming Athletic Bilbao, they have scored their third consecutive victory, hoisting themselves up to sixth place.
De Zerbi is leaning toward confirming Greenwood from the first minute, flanked by O’Riley and Paixao behind the’only forward Aubameyang. In midfield, former Inter Milan man Kondogbia with Hojbjerg, in defense another former Nerazzurri: there’s Pavard alongside Balerdi.
Howe confirms Woltemade in the center of the attack, while Elanga, favored over Gordon, and Barnes will complete the offensive trident. L’ex Milan Tonali in the midfield booth, defense headed by another former Rossoneri: Thiaw.
Probable lineups
Marseille (4-2-3-1): Rulli; Weah, Pavard, Balerdi, Emerson; HĂžjbjerg, Kondogbia; Greenwood, O’Riley, Paixao; Aubameyang. Coach: De Zerbi.

Newcastle (4-3-3): Pope; Livramento, Thiaw, Botman, Burn; Guimaraes, Tonali, Joelinton; Elanga, Woltemade, Barnes. Coach: Howe.
